[ ] Step 4 — Meritstack loyalty ledger key rotation. Verify both custodians are present and the Ardenvale signing module is offline. Generate the new ledger key, record the fingerprint in the ceremony log, and confirm escrow upload. To validate the escrow copy, decrypt the test bundle with the recovery passphrase below.

vault phrase of kajop-bahof = fenys-pelix-quenax-sildor-lammir-pelix-pelox-belwyn-zorok

- [ ] Step 7: Archive cold storage buckets (Glacierline tier). Confirm both ceremony witnesses are present, verify bucket manifests match the Oxbow ledger, then seal the archive key shares. Plugin authors may observe but not handle shares. Once sealed, the archive index itself is encrypted and can only be reopened with the passphrase below.

vault phrase of badup-hahig = tamael-aldael-kelmir-istael-fenok-istwyn-tamius-jorath-oliion

Verify the Slatemoor markdown pipeline strips raw HTML, inline scripts, and data URIs before render. Confirm sanitizer version matches the pinned manifest and fuzz corpus passed with zero escapes. Sign-off blocked until both checks are green. Reference the verified build by the token below.

pipeline stamp: htk9_ce63042d9

Ticket #—: Cutoff-rule vault locked

The Hearthrow bakery's order-cutoff configuration lives in the Crumbsafe vault, which auto-locked after three failed edits during last week's timezone fix. Future maintainers: do not recreate the rule by hand; the vault copy is canonical. Unlock it from the admin console, entering the recovery passphrase noted below.

vault phrase of taguf-taguf = ralath-briwyn

### Calendar Sync Conflicts (Plannerly ↔ Daybridge)

When Plannerly and Daybridge both edit the same event, the sync worker flags a conflict and halts that calendar's queue. Resolve via the conflicts dashboard: pick the authoritative copy, then resume the queue. Most conflicts come from recurring-event edits. If the queue store is locked after a crash, reopen it with the recovery passphrase below.

vault phrase of taweg-kafof = oliax-zorael